Boston Civil War Tours offers a captivating 90-minute historic walk through the city, delving into its pivotal role in both the fight to Abolish Slavery and to Save the Union during the American Civil War.

Discover the intriguing stories of notable figures such as John Wilkes Booth, Louisa May Alcott, Jefferson Davis, and Frederick Douglass, as you explore significant sites like the Robert Gould Shaw Memorial, Holmes Alleyway on the Underground Railroad, the Home of Louisa May Alcott, and Park Street Church.
